Aerial footage of crews tackling Dorset heath fire

About 200 firefighters are tackling a very large fire which is spreading rapidly across heathland in Dorset, putting homes at risk.

Strong winds are causing the fire, on about three sq km (740 acres) of Upton Heath, Poole, to quickly spread.

Eyewitness Steve Davis of Dorset Wildlife Trust described the impact and extent of the blaze.
